The GMAT Total Score scale ranges from 205 to 805, and all Total Score values end in a 5. Section scores range from 60 to 90.
Score Type | Score Range | Score Intervals | Standard Error of Measurement |
---|---|---|---|
Total Score | 205-805 | 10 | 30-40 points |
Quantitative Reasoning Score | 60-90 | 1 | 3 points |
Verbal Reasoning Score | 60-90 | 1 | 3 points |
Data Insights Score | 60-90 | 1 | 3 points |
If you're familiar with the previous edition of the GMAT, you'll notice the Total Score scale is different. This change has been made to ensure you and schools can easily distinguish between a GMAT Exam - Focus Edition and previous GMAT Exam score.
Exam | Total Score Range |
---|---|
GMAT Exam - Focus Edition | 205-805 |
Previous edition of the GMAT Exam | 200-800 |
The score scale for the GMAT Exam - Focus Edition has also been adjusted to reflect changes in the test-taking population, which has become more diverse and global. Over the years, scores have shifted significantly, resulting in an uneven distribution. The updated score scale fixes that, thus allowing schools to better differentiate your performance on the exam.
